Lasting Powers of Attorney registration fee refunds

If you registered Lasting Powers of Attorney between 1st April 2013 and 31st March 2017, you could be entitled to a refund of the registration fee.

Have you registered Lasting Powers of Attorney between 1st April 2013 and 31st March 2017? If so, you could be entitled to a refund of the registration fee, but only if you claim it before February 2021. We have helped many of our clients obtain a refund. The process is clear and simple.
